| Do they make some sort of small "hobby" welder that can handle small projects like this? I mean, you wouldnt need a big 220 Miller for this. Something that wouldnt break the bank would be cool to have. |
| | |
| | #13 |
| Rock Crawler Join Date: Jan 2004 Location: Santa Cruz, CA
Posts: 620
| you can get a small flux core welder but you will have some splater. that is why alot of people use MIG. you can pick up a low end welder for about $150.00 on ebay. i just droped $800 on mine. |
| | |
| | #14 |
| Rock Crawler Join Date: Mar 2004 Location: BAY AREA
Posts: 545
| Harbor freight has some real cheap one that should work for what we all do. Mine was $600, and its overkill for the cages, but I also did my toyota mods with it. Its nice to have the power, cuz if one of those welds break I might not be able to post anymore. |
